Basil Blackwell, 1970. Journal. Good. Paperback. Ex-library copy with library stamps on front cover; cover & page edges browning with heavy foxing to front cover, a little dusty, else a sound, tight copy. 215x140mm. Contents include: An essay on Pastoral by Laurence Lerner; Allegory and personality in Spenser's heroes by K W Gransden; A guide to The New Inn by Douglas Duncan; The fall of Gulliver's Master by Steward Lacasce; Mr Perry's Patients: a view of Emma by J W Watson..
